Nottingham

Nottingham is located in the east midlands in the UK, and is the home to two universities and about 20,000 students. This leads to lots of Cheese clubs, with uni nights being spread around Ocean, Oceana and Isis on monday, wednesday and friday. Stealth is the only real club, and is home to a glittering multitude of nights. File:Http://www.lightrailnow.org/images/not-uk-map-rev.jpg


== Stealth == [Website]

The home of many nights from nottingham and around the country. Small and pokey, but still good nights can be had.

=== Detonate === [Website]

Drum and Bass night which always features massive acts from around the country and overseas

Spectrum

House Breakbeat night which is a bit off/on

=== Product === [website]

House and Breakbeat which is also a bit off/on

=== Firefly === [Website]

The best atmosphere clubnight in nottingham, this has ditched Stealth as a venue at the end of 2005, and now has a monthly residency in the Marcus Garvey Centre. Has a reputation for featuring new acts for the first time in nottingham.

Starting life at the Nottingham Summer Party in 2000, the first 3 years saw regular slots at the Marcus Garvey Ballroom. With massive amounts of effort put into the décor of the venue, and a lot of thought going into the lineup, Firefly quickly built up a reputation in the midlands for hosting a party like no other.

Between then and now, Firefly hosted its legendary residency at the infamous, but now sadly defunct club, The Bomb, as well as appearing at many great events including Nottingham Summer Party every year. Since The Bomb closed, a slot opened at Nottingham's newest nightclub, Stealth and we resided there for a year up until now…
